Thailand Threatened by Tsunami: Tourists Evacuated
Thailand once again has been threatened by tsunami. Waves rise up to four meters can be covered Phuket, Krabi, Phi Phi, Phangan and other islands and resorts in the Andaman Sea on Wednesday, April 11, in the afternoon (and Thai – in the evening). The giant wave was formed after a powerful earthquake on the Indonesian island of Sumatra.
According to other forecasts, wave heights will be no more than 20 meters. However, to prevent a possible disaster in the kingdom this has been taken very seriously. After all, everyone remembers the terrible tsunami that has covered Thailand – including the popular resorts – in December 2004.
Thai authorities have declared about the Volume, that they are ready to evacuate the the inhabitants from coastal districts of the southern provinces to the safe places. And also the tourists, holiday makers on Phuket, Krabi and the Pangani have begun exported out from the seaside hotels to the internal districts of of the islands from the Wednesday after noon. This information was confirmed by the Federal Tourism Agency.
Also there has been a lot of panic in the streets of Indonesia as Double Quake hits the Aceh coast earlier today. The first earthquake magnitudes 8.7 and after 4 hours there has been another after shocks of powerful 8.2 magnitude. Tsunami warning has been issued and the cities have started evacuating.
